Like UI testing, Web pages testing is a question that we often hear.
For a lot of people, this kind of testing is impossible – well, let’s
say very hard to do -, so they don’t do it.

Difficult doesn’t mean impossible and there are now several good testing tools. The most difficult to test is the behaviour of our code across several kind of browsers. Each of them interpret HTML and Javascript as they
want so our beautiful code can be sometimes unreadable. If we want to perform a real test, we need to test our code inside the browser. I discover that this is exactly what Selenium does. This tool was originally created by people at ThoughtWorks, so I presume that it was designed with agile testing in mind. I’ll have a look at it in the following days.

